The models that shipped
| Release | Maker | What's notable | Availability |
|---|---|---|---|
| Claude Sonnet 5 | Anthropic | Became the default model across all Claude plans on June 30 — stronger long-run coding, tool use, and debugging at a lower price | Live now |
| GPT-5.6 (Sol, Terra, Luna) | OpenAI | Broad release after a staggered rollout and consultation with US Commerce Department officials over national-security review | Live now |
| Kimi K3 | Moonshot AI | A 2.8-trillion-parameter open-weight model — the largest open model released to date, with a 1-million-token context window | API/apps live now; full open weights July 27 |
| Gemini 3.6 Flash | Latest in Google's fast-tier model line, continuing the push toward cheaper, longer-context models | Live now |
The pattern across nearly all of July's releases: longer and cheaper context windows, stronger step-by-step reasoning modes to cut down on hallucinations, and smaller on-device variants for local, private use. If 2024 was the year of chatbots, 2026 is clearly the year of agents — most major platforms this month shipped agent frameworks aimed at handling narrow, well-defined jobs with minimal supervision, not general-purpose autonomy.
The policy story getting less attention than it deserves
France's competition authority published a lengthy advisory opinion on the AI agent market this month — and it didn't just review filings, it built and ran its own AI agents through hundreds of real shopping-related prompts to see how they behave in practice. The headline finding: OpenAI, Google, and Anthropic together control the large majority of the AI agent market, a concentration level regulators are now treating as a live concern rather than a hypothetical one.
Separately, the Future of Life Institute's latest AI Safety Index found that several major developers have weakened or dropped voluntary commitments to pause development if a model crosses specific risk thresholds. Anthropic ranked highest among labs assessed; most others scored lower, and at least one lab disputed the methodology as unfairly penalizing open-weight releases. Worth reading as a snapshot of a contested, evolving debate rather than a settled verdict — the labs themselves don't agree on whether the grading is fair.
Access risk is now a real deployment consideration
One of July's quieter but more consequential developments: Anthropic briefly suspended access to its Claude Fable 5 and Claude Mythos 5 models in mid-June to comply with US export control rules, restoring access on July 1 once the relevant controls were lifted. The specifics matter less than the pattern — frontier model access can now change on short notice for policy reasons unrelated to the model itself. If your product or workflow depends on a specific frontier model, that's no longer a purely theoretical risk to plan around; it happened, publicly, this quarter.
Where the money is going
Etched, a startup building specialized AI inference chips, launched this month with a $5 billion valuation and over $1 billion in signed contracts already in hand. That's a strong signal that demand for dedicated inference capacity — the hardware that actually runs AI models cheaply at scale — is now large enough to support an entirely new wave of hardware-focused companies, not just the existing GPU giants.
The takeaway
Three things are worth carrying forward from this month specifically: agentic AI is moving out of demos and into paid, production use; pricing and access now matter almost as much as raw model quality when choosing what to build on; and infrastructure and policy are starting to determine who can ship quickly and who gets slowed down, in ways that have nothing to do with whose model is technically best. If you're picking a model or platform to build on right now, that's the more useful lens than any single benchmark score.
